Members of the Graphic Communications International Union, AFL-CIO, CLC, the largest and most progressive union in the printing industry in North America, recently voted to merge with the International Brotherhood of Teamsters to become the Graphic Communications Conference of the International Brotherhood of Teamsters, or, more simply GCC/IBT.
The 175,000 members of the GCC/IBT belong to over 500 local unions in the United States and Canada. Individually and collectively, they are dedicated to advancing the economic and other interests of their industry and of working people.

The former GCIU was the result of five mergers. [For details, see GCIU History.] In an era of revolutionary
technological change in communications -- accompanied by wholesale corporate
restructuring worldwide -- the GCIU's organic drive to unite
all crafts within the graphic arts industry represents the only
effective way for working people to meet these challenges.
